IP查询
查询
你查询的IP:[119.238.127.146] 地理位置:日本
最新查询
220.160.83.180
117.59.36.127
121.60.57.179
119.41.61.235
118.89.107.92
117.24.65.151
123.249.185.31
117.21.174.50
202.95.115.146
119.238.127.146
60.255.4.63
118.88.128.144
116.214.128.136
202.131.208.9
118.244.94.157
60.232.174.19
125.210.101.205
202.60.112.244
60.55.230.244
221.199.192.246
218.64.214.138
125.216.29.133
221.122.148.2
202.22.248.7
121.201.161.170
202.130.224.139
118.132.36.221
161.207.1.0
119.16.35.237
202.150.16.79
120.64.248.10